News summary

A massive collapse of the Birch Glacier in the Swiss Alps caused a devastating landslide that buried about 90% of the village of Blatten under rock, ice, and mud, prompting an evacuation of around 300 residents and livestock earlier this month. A 64-year-old man remains missing after the event, despite extensive search and rescue efforts involving drones, thermal cameras, the army, and airlifted specialists. The debris from the landslide has blocked the nearby Lonza River, creating a risk of flooding due to a potentially dammed water flow, which adds to concerns about further disaster. Swiss officials and experts have expressed shock at the scale of the destruction and have linked the glacier's collapse to permafrost degradation and rising temperatures in the Alps, with climate change considered a significant contributing factor to the accelerated retreat of glaciers in recent years. The incident highlights Switzerland's ongoing struggle with glacier melt and the associated risks to Alpine communities, as the country lost 4% of its glacier volume in 2023 following a 6% loss in 2022. Authorities continue to monitor the situation closely, with fears that the conditions could worsen.
